MySQL是一個常見的關系型數據庫管理系統,廣泛應用于企業級應用程序開發中。在使用MySQL進行數據查詢時,經常會需要為查詢結果添加行號,以方便用戶查看和操作數據。下面就來介紹一下如何在MySQL中為數據添加行號。
MySQL中實現添加行號的方法比較簡單,只需要使用MySQL內置的自增ID功能和變量來完成即可。下面是示例代碼:
SELECT @rownum:=@rownum+1 as rownum, t.* FROM (SELECT * FROM table_name ORDER BY column_name) t, (SELECT @rownum:=0) r
在這個示例代碼中,我們首先使用SELECT語句查詢了所有的數據,并按照指定的列名進行了排序。然后,我們定義了一個名為@rownum的變量,并且給它賦了初始值0。最后,我們使用SELECT語句再次查詢數據,并在查詢結果中使用自增ID功能為每一行數據添加了一個行號。
在該代碼示例中,t表示我們的數據表,而r則表示我們的自增變量。使用這種方式,我們就可以非常方便地為MySQL查詢結果添加行號了。
總之,MySQL作為一款成熟和穩定的數據庫管理系統,為我們提供了廣泛且靈活的數據管理工具。在開發過程中,我們可以利用MySQL的自增ID功能和變量,輕松地為數據添加行號,進而為用戶提供更好的數據體驗和操作體驗。
上一篇css自動編號計數器
下一篇css自動連跳指令